Just wanna say, I've been taking this probiotic for a couple months now and I really love it. Ingredients: L. acidopholus, B. bifidum, B. longum. Other ingredients: potato starch, gelatin, silicon dioxide.

The bottle lasts a month if you take one capsule a day, and it costs around 12 dollars at Wal-Mart.

I should, but I always forget to take them. I am not right now.

There haven't been many isolated strains shown to be effective for some symptoms of IBS, but this is one strain. Some people are helped with gas with them and perhaps then pain.

Bifidobacterium infantis 35624

Its in AlignŽ

I can't really recommend one other then to say just try one and see if it helps. There are a lot of different kinds, like activa yogurt , which my wife who also has IBS eats once in a while, she can go back and forth and it does seem to help her some. The new phillips colon health that Dana just tried and liked perhaps.

The gut bacteria are different in different people and even where they live. Someone in oregon doesn't really have the same as in say florida, because it helps protect us to our own environments. Foods, and even stress can mess with it all and change them.

It could be worth trying though and is not likely to hurt anything.
